I want to share tips for save mail attachment file to File System when a new mail arrives.
Flow scenario:
When a new mail arrives with attachment file, Save it to Folder in my File Server.
Flow detail:
1. Trigger: Office 365 Outlook - When a new mail arrives ( Has Attachment = Yes, Include Attachment = Yes )
2. Apply-to-each (Attacements)
2-1. Action: File System - Create File ( Folder Path = C:/Flow/Mail Attachment, File name = Subject - Name, File Content = Content)
Flow Tips:
Trigger "When a new mail attachment" - Property "Include Attachments" must need "Yes".
